Lead Certificate

Lead Certified Siding Contractor in Whatcom County

We are proudly LEAD-SAFE Certified by the State of Washington. For homes built prior to 1978, a lead-certified contractor is required to perform any siding replacement or renovation work (even if lead is not detected). If lead-based materials are detected on homes built after 1978, it is mandatory to engage a lead certified contractor, as failure to comply with these regulations may result in penalties and fines.

About Lopez Island

Home improvement project costs on Lopez Island, Washington, can be significantly higher than the national average, influenced by factors such as local labor rates, the cost of materials, and the island’s specific climate-related challenges. This remote location in the San Juan Islands presents unique hurdles for homeowners who need to maintain or upgrade their properties. While the stunning natural beauty and peaceful lifestyle draw people to Lopez Island, understanding the costs of home improvements is essential for those living in or considering purchasing property in this area.

One of the primary contributors to the higher costs of home improvements on Lopez Island is local labor rates. The island’s small size and its location away from major cities means there is a limited supply of skilled tradespeople. Many contractors need to travel from other islands or the mainland, which increases their overhead costs. These travel costs are then passed on to the homeowner, driving up labor rates. In more urbanized areas, there is a greater supply of skilled laborers and contractors, and the competition among them often leads to lower prices. On Lopez Island, however, the need for specialists in areas like roofing, siding, or window installation is high, and with fewer contractors available, prices for these services are generally higher.

Material costs also play a significant role in the total cost of home improvement projects. Lopez Island’s remote location means that most building materials must be shipped from the mainland, adding shipping and transportation fees to the base price of materials. While Seattle and other nearby urban centers provide easy access to a variety of materials, the shipping costs make everything from lumber to specialty siding more expensive. Given the island’s proximity to the ocean and its exposure to saltwater, homeowners often opt for materials that can withstand the harsh marine environment, such as durable fiber-cement siding or metal roofing. While these materials are designed to protect homes from moisture and corrosion, they come at a premium compared to less durable options.

The climate in Lopez Island also plays a key role in the costs of home improvements. The island experiences a temperate climate with mild, wet winters and cool, dry summers. This means that homes are constantly exposed to moisture, which can accelerate wear and tear, particularly on siding, decks, and roofing. The increased need for moisture-resistant materials like fiber-cement siding or treated wood, combined with the island’s relatively high humidity, makes exterior repairs and maintenance projects common. Homeowners who neglect these projects may face more severe damage in the future, particularly from rot and mold, which can result in even higher repair costs if left unaddressed.

For many homeowners on Lopez Island, home improvement is essential to keep their properties in good condition and to preserve or increase their market value. Given the island’s appeal as a tranquil, scenic location, homes that are well-maintained and updated are more likely to attract potential buyers if they are put on the market. Properties that have seen regular maintenance or improvement, such as siding replacements or roofing repairs, tend to hold their value better and are less susceptible to the kind of damage that could result in decreased appeal. This is particularly important in a place like Lopez Island, where real estate transactions may not be as frequent as in more urbanized areas. Homeowners seeking to enhance the marketability of their properties or simply maintain their homes are often compelled to invest in these improvements.

The median income on Lopez Island is lower than the national average, which can pose challenges when homeowners attempt to complete larger home improvement projects. While homeowners may be able to afford smaller repairs or cosmetic updates, major renovations—such as replacing siding, installing energy-efficient windows, or undertaking large-scale roofing repairs—can be financially daunting. The high cost of labor and materials in the area can make these projects difficult to manage without outside financing. As a result, many homeowners seek financing options to help cover the upfront costs of home improvements, allowing them to complete necessary updates without putting undue stress on their finances.

The most common types of home improvement projects that require financing on Lopez Island are those related to the exterior of the home. These include siding replacements, roof repairs, and window upgrades. Due to the island’s wet climate, siding replacement is particularly common, as homes exposed to the constant moisture can experience damage more quickly than homes in drier regions. Roof repairs are also frequently needed, especially as older roofs begin to deteriorate from exposure to the elements. Installing new windows, particularly energy-efficient models, is another popular home improvement project, as these upgrades help homeowners reduce heating costs during the cooler months. These projects often require substantial investment due to the need for high-quality materials and skilled labor.

Delaying home improvement projects on Lopez Island can result in long-term costs that exceed the initial investment. Issues like water damage, rot, and structural deterioration can worsen over time, leading to more expensive repairs. For example, a small leak in the roof or damaged siding can eventually lead to mold growth, rot, or even foundation damage, which can be far more expensive to repair than addressing the issue early on. Furthermore, waiting to replace old windows or siding can result in increased heating costs, as homes lose energy efficiency. Homeowners who delay these improvements may end up paying more for repairs in the future, making timely updates a wiser financial decision.

Compared to nearby areas, such as Anacortes or Bellingham, home improvement costs on Lopez Island tend to be higher due to the cost of shipping materials and the limited availability of skilled labor. While these areas may offer more affordable options in terms of contractors and building supplies, the remote location of Lopez Island adds extra costs to every project. This factor should be considered by potential homeowners, as the ongoing costs of maintaining a property on the island may be higher than in more urbanized areas.
